New Screening Method Makes Diagnosis of Autism in Children Easier

A new study published in the journal Frontiers in Neuroscience reports on the development of a new screening method that can diagnose autism without relying on subjective criteria. The studies, funded by a US (Dollar) 650,000 grant from the National Science Foundation, were led by Elizabeth Torres, a computational neuroscientist, and Dimitri Metaxas, a computer scientist, both at Rutgers University, in collaboration with Jorge V.
